Overview
Print transformed the way knowledge, religion, politics, and daily life worked across the world. The earliest printing traditions began in East Asia, especially China, Japan, and Korea, and later spread to Europe and India. Printed books appeared in China from
Printed books appeared in China from AD 594 using inked woodblocks and paper. Buddhist missionaries carried hand-printing to Japan around AD 768-770.
